The Invisible Forces Shaping Your Everyday Life

Every home operates on five core elements:
- Fire (Agni) – energy, transformation, ambition
- Water (Jal) – flow, emotions, opportunities
- Air (Vayu) – movement, communication
- Earth (Prithvi) – stability, grounding
- Space (Aakash) – expansion, possibility

Room-by-Room Energy Breakdown
Living Room: The Energy Gateway

- Ideal: Open, well-lit, clutter-free
- Avoid: Heavy furniture blocking flow
- Impact: Influences social energy and opportunities
Bedroom: Your Energy Reset Zone

- Ideal: Balanced colours, proper bed direction
- Avoid: Mirrors facing the bed
- Impact: Affects sleep, relationships, mental peace
Kitchen: The Wealth Generator

- Ideal: Fire element aligned correctly (usually southeast)
- Avoid: Water and fire clashing
- Impact: Direct link to financial stability
Workspace: The Productivity Engine

- Ideal: Facing a direction that enhances focus
- Avoid: Back facing entrance
- Impact: Career growth and decision-making clarity
Entrance: The Energy Portal

- Ideal: Clean, inviting, energetically open
- Avoid: Obstructions, dull lighting
- Impact: Determines what kind of energy enters your life

FAQs: Vastu Interior Design & Energy Alignment
1. What is Vastu interior design?
It is the practice of designing interiors based on directional energy, elemental balance, and spatial alignment to enhance well-being and success.
2. Does Vastu really affect energy in a home?
Yes, Vastu influences how energy flows within a space, which can impact mental clarity, relationships, and productivity.
3. What is the difference between Vastu and MahaVastu?
Vastu provides traditional guidelines, while MahaVastu offers precise, practical solutions based on energy mapping.
4. Can existing homes be corrected without reconstruction?
Absolutely. MahaVastu focuses on remedies that do not require demolition or major structural changes.
5. How do I know if my home has negative energy?
Signs include constant stress, lack of progress, health issues, or a general feeling of heaviness in the space.
6. Which direction is best for a bedroom according to Vastu?
Southwest is generally considered ideal for stability and restful sleep.
7. Is Vastu relevant for modern apartments?
Yes, Vastu principles can be adapted to any space, including compact urban homes.
